Free shipping on eBay. How?
 
Can anyone give me some suggestion or tip on shipping? I see electronic items (headphones for example) sold for 5-10$, free shipping. I am just wondering how is it possible to offer free shipping if it will probably cost as much to ship, also don't forget listing price and eBay&PayPal fees. It's almost impossible. Anyone knows the secret to how some sellers are able to offer free shipping on such items? I heard CanadaPost has some business discount for businesses who send over 30 items a day but I don't know their rates. Maybe someone will enlighten me.

Use flat rate shipping so you will know cost ahead of time and include that in your BIN price. With auctions a bit more difficult, then start price should at minimum cover shipping costs....

Example....

Say with product cost, fees and shipping is $6.38 Then your listing should be anything above that. If you cannot then you didnt get the best deal or they bought larger quantity.
